Vacc, Nicholas A.; Burt, Marilyn A. – Behavioral Disorders, 1980
The study investigated possible differences between 113 children identified as emotionally handicapped and 368 normal children with regard to cognitive complexity (ability to differentiate among behavioral dimensions in the social environment). (Author/SB)
